0

だから私の質問は、足場を生成した後、自分のサイトに記事を投稿できるようになった後です。通常は www.mysite.com/articles/1 のようなリンクです

私の質問は...あなたのアプリケーションがあなたの www.mysite.com/articles/1 ページへのリンクを自動的に生成することは可能ですか?

今は手動で HTML にアクセスしてリンクを追加する必要があるためです。

=link_to 'my article', /articles/1 

アプリケーションに自動的にリンクを生成させることが可能かどうか疑問に思っていましたか?

4

1 に答える 1

0

はい、可能です。リンクしたい記事への質問に基づいてわかりませんがresources、ルートでこれを使用して設定している場合、これは機能するはずです:

<ul>
  <% Article.all do |article| %>
    <li><%= link_to article.title, article %></li>
  <% end %>
</ul>

または、HAML を使用している場合 (質問の形式に基づいているように見えますが、指定していません:

%ul
  - Article.all do |article|
    %li= link_to article.title, article

必要に応じて、クエリを変更して、結果を制限したり、ページ分割したり、並べ替えたりすることができます。

于 2012-12-12T02:00:25.067 に答える